Cardinal Newman barely beat Heathwood Hall Episcopal the last time the pair played, but that sure wasn't the case this time around. The Cardinals never let the Highlanders get on the board and left with a 4-0 win on Thursday. The high-scoring performance was a welcome turnaround for Cardinal Newman's offense, which had struggled in the games prior.
They hit Heathwood Hall Episcopal with a three-pronged attack, as the team got scores from Abby Bodman (2), Moxie Vallee, and Taylor Defreese.

Cardinal Newman's victory bumped their record up to 4-9. As for Heathwood Hall Episcopal, their defeat was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 2-8-1.
Coincidentally, Cardinal Newman and Heathwood Hall Episcopal will both be playing Augusta Christian the next time they take the pitch. The Cardinals will host the Lions at 5:00 p.m. on Monday, while the Highlanders will head out to face them at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
